View Top Employees for Merlin Telecom
img Website merlin-telecom.com
img Industry Information Technology And Services
img Location Miami, Florida, United States
img Employees 9
img Founded 2000
img Website merlin-telecom.com
img Industry Information Technology And Services
img Location Miami, Florida, United States
img Employees 9
img Founded 2000
img LinkedIn linkedin.com/company/merlin-telecom

Top Merlin Telecom Employees